Trump Tariff Troubles: GoI should allow reverse job work from SEEPZ, says Kirit Bhansali, Chairman, GJEPC
With the steep Trump tariffs now having come into play, the cutting, polishing, manufacturing and export hubs of India are facing severe problems, with joblessness and unit-closure a distinct possibility. The silver lining is that the GJEPC is hopeful of a solution, particularly in view of the advocacy efforts of its US counterparts, who are also working hard to impress upon the Trump administration that the high tariffs will have a deleterious effect on the US jewellery industry as well. In a free-wheeling conversation with Suneeta Kaul, Kirit Bhansali, Chairman, GJEPC, talks about the impact of the tariffs, the steps being taken to bring about some relief to the industry, its expectation from the government, and more.
Land Allocation for the Jaipur Gem and Jewellery Bourse has been approved
The Rajasthan Govt. has approved the allocation of roughly 44,000 square meters of land at the reserve rate for the construction and development of the Jaipur Gem and Jewellery Bourse, marking a key step in enhancing India's gem and jewellery industry.

Manufacturers' Woes-What manufacturers are concerned about ?
Covid-19 has affected every single stakeholder in the gems and jewellery industry. As demand for jewellery remains subdued in India, jewellery manufacturers worry about receiving payments from retailers, paying their staff salaries and managing overheads and the most important of all, getting back their karigars who have migrated back to their hometowns says Vijetha Rangabashyam
Jewellers Association Jaipur Joins Forces with Rajasthan Government to Combat Coronavirus
The Jewellers Association Jaipur has offered its 80-bed Janopyogi Bhawan to house Coronavirus patients in quarantine
